Transaction 8b375361864301050358266737752fe0374259bd1d26635f450a54de2a8ead15
1 Input
1 Output
-
8b375361864301050358266737752fe0374259bd1d26635f450a54de2a8ead15:0
- value
- 29828338
- script pubkey
- OP_0 OP_PUSHBYTES_20 07c8af856c8bea67c46613c913f04c9802ea73fe
- address
- bc1qqly2lptv304x03rxz0y38uzvnqpw5ul7zxeur2